Kileleshwa MCA, Robert Alai, has thrown a tough warning at Governor Sakaja, saying MCAs are ready to kick him out if he doesn’t change how he runs things in the next two months.
Speaking on a local TV station on Monday, September 8, 2025, Alai accused Sakaja of being arrogant and disrespectful to MCAs, claiming he feels untouchable because he thinks he controls the majority side in the assembly.
Alai said: “Sakaja has been really arrogant and rough with MCAs because he thought he had the majority secured. That’s why Raila told him to apologize and actually act on what the MCAs have raised.”
He also added that even though people claim the earlier impeachment push was stopped because of bribes, MCAs are still serious about holding him accountable.
“If impeachment was stopped because money exchanged hands, that’s just a story. We’re telling Sakaja again if he doesn’t change in the next two months (which he won’t), we’ll impeach him,” Alai warned.
